Guernsey coach Andy Cornford says his team can still improve, despite their emphatic 148-run win over Jersey in Saturday's inter-insular.

"I was very pleased with the way we played, but it wasn't a complete performance," Cornford told BBC Guernsey after the victory.

"I think there were some dismissals that we need to look at."

Guernsey meet Jersey in their opening match at the ICC WCL Division Six tournament in Malaysia.

"It was a good performance, don't get me wrong , but I still think there's to come more from us," he added.
